Information stories also include at the very least one of the following essential characteristics relative to the designated audience: proximity, importance, timeliness, human interest, quirk, or effect.


Within these limits, newspaper article likewise intend to be comprehensive. Various other variables are included, some stylistic and some derived from the media form. Amongst the larger and much more revered papers, fairness and equilibrium is a major aspect in providing details. Commentary is generally constrained to a different area, though each paper might have a different general slant.


Papers with a worldwide target market, as an example, often tend to use a more formal design of composing. The particular choices made by a news electrical outlet's editor or editorial board are often gathered in a style guide; usual design guides consist of the and the United States News Design Publication. The main goals of information writing can be summarized by the ABCs of journalism: precision, brevity, and quality.

As a guideline, journalists will not utilize a lengthy word when a short one will do. News authors attempt to prevent utilizing the same word extra than once in a paragraph (in some cases called an "echo" or "word mirror").


Nonetheless, headlines sometimes leave out the topic (e.g., "Jumps From Boat, Catches in Wheel") or verb (e.g., "Cat woman fortunate"). A subhead (also subhed, sub-headline, subheading, subtitle, deck or dek) can be either a subservient title under the major headline, or the heading of a subsection of the article. It is a heading that precedes the primary text, or a team of paragraphs of the major text.

While a guideline of thumb claims the lead needs to address most or every one of the 5 Ws, few leads can fit every one of these - News Articles. Article leads are in some cases classified right into tough leads and soft article leads. A tough lead intends to supply a detailed thesis which informs the visitor what the article will cover.


Instance of a hard-lead paragraph NASA is proposing an additional area project. The spending plan requests approximately $10 billion for the task.


The NASA statement came as the agency asked for $10 billion of appropriations for the job. An "off-lead" is the second essential front web page information of the day. The off-lead appears either in the leading left corner, or straight below the lead on the right. To "bury the lead" is to start the short article with background details or information of secondary relevance to the viewers, compeling them to find out more deeply right into a write-up than they must need to in order to find the important points.

Typical usage is that or more sentences each develop their very own paragraph. Reporters usually define the organization or framework of a newspaper article as an upside down pyramid. The vital and most intriguing elements of a story are placed at the beginning, with sustaining info complying with in order of lessening relevance.


It allows people to explore a subject to just the depth that their inquisitiveness takes them, and without the charge of information or nuances that they might think about unimportant, but still making that pop over to these guys details available to more interested viewers. The upside down pyramid structure also allows posts to be trimmed to any type of approximate length throughout format, to suit the room readily available.

Function tales differ from straight information in several means. Foremost is the lack of a straight-news lead, a lot of the time. Rather than supplying the significance of a tale up front, function authors may try to lure visitors in.




All About News Articles


The journalist frequently information communications with meeting topics, making the piece extra individual. An attribute's initial paragraphs commonly relate an appealing minute or event, as in an "unscientific lead". From the particulars of a person or episode, its view swiftly widens to abstract principles regarding the story's subject. The area that signals what a feature is her explanation around is called the or signboard.
